A pear-cut tiger eye cabochon in a beaded white metal bezel, framed by scrolled filigree on either side.
Tiger eye has chatoyancy — a band of light that slides across the stone as it turns, like the pupil of a cat's eye narrowing. Golden brown, striped through with darker bands.
Tiger eye is traditionally worn for courage and clear-headedness, a stone for holding your nerve.
Materials: natural tiger eye, white metal.
Materials note: crafted from a brass and white metal alloy, not sterling silver or fine gold. Where a piece isn't described otherwise, it has a silver-tone finish; where the description mentions brass, gold, or clay tone, that piece carries a warmer, more aged patina instead. Same handmade materials throughout, just different finishes.
